Understanding Agent Assist Technology Core Definition: Real-time artificial intelligence (AI) that monitors customer interactions, understands context and intent, and provides agents with relevant information, guidance, and recommendations during conversations to improve outcomes. This technology is essential for logistics and shipping customer service teams, where timely and accurate responses can significantly impact customer satisfaction and operational efficiency. What It's NOT: Not just a searchable knowledge base Not static scripts or call flows Not post-call quality scoring Not a chatbot or IVR system The Technology Stack: Layer 1: Conversation Intelligence Real-time speech-to-text and text analysis that captures and understands conversations. Transcription accuracy (95%+ enterprise-grade) and sub-second latency are critical. Intent and entity recognition to help agents understand customer needs. Layer 2: Context Engine Understands conversation meaning, customer sentiment, and call purpose. Customer intent analysis and emotional sentiment detection are crucial for effective responses. Integration with CRM and history for personalized service. Layer 3: Intelligence & Decision Engine AI that determines what guidance to provide based on context. If a customer is frustrated, it suggests de-escalation prompts; if there’s a compliance moment, it provides required disclosures. Layer 4: Presentation & Delivery User interface displaying guidance without disrupting agent workflow. Knowledge article cards, script suggestions, and real-time alerts enhance the agent's ability to respond effectively. Layer 5: Integration Framework Connections to contact center platforms, CRM, and knowledge systems ensure seamless operation. Layer 6: Analytics & Optimization Performance measurement and continuous improvement through data analytics. Understanding Agent Assist Technology Core Definition: Real-time guidance, often powered by AI, refers to the technology that monitors customer interactions, understands context and intent, and provides agents with relevant information, guidance, and recommendations during conversations. This approach is designed to improve outcomes by enabling agents to respond more effectively and efficiently. What It's NOT: Not just a searchable knowledge base Not static scripts or call flows Not post-call quality scoring Not a chatbot or IVR system The technology operates through multiple layers, each contributing to a seamless experience for both agents and customers. The Technology Stack: Conversation Intelligence: Real-time speech-to-text and text analysis that captures and understands conversations. Context Engine: Understands conversation meaning, customer sentiment, and call purpose. Intelligence & Decision Engine: AI that determines what guidance to provide based on context. Presentation & Delivery: User interface displaying guidance without disrupting agent workflow. Integration Framework: Connections to contact center platforms, CRM, and knowledge systems. Analytics & Optimization: Performance measurement and continuous improvement. This multi-layered approach ensures that agents have the tools they need at their fingertips, ultimately leading to improved quality scores. Implementation Considerations To successfully implement real-time guidance technology, organizations should consider the following critical success factors: 1. Executive Sponsorship: A C-level champion can help remove obstacles and drive adoption. 2. Cross-Functional Alignment: Involve IT, operations, training, and quality assurance teams early in the process. 3. Change Management: Ensure effective communication, training, and support for adoption. 4. Integration Testing: Conduct thorough testing before going live to ensure seamless operation. 5. Phased Rollout: Start with a pilot program, then gradually expand to the entire team. Timeline: Weeks 1-4: Foundation (requirements, integration, content). Weeks 5-8: Configuration (testing, training preparation). Weeks 9-10: Pilot Launch. Weeks 11-12: Optimization. Weeks 13-16: Full Deployment.
